The recent news about the alleged involvement of Dutch hackers in the security breach suffered by the telecommunications operator Odido has once again put on the table the challenges facing cybersecurity at a global level. Police in the Netherlands have found 'strong indications' that Dutch citizens may have been involved in the attack that occurred in February, which not only raises concerns in the telecommunications sector, but also invites reflection on the increasing sophistication of digital threats and the importance of robust protection strategies.
Odido, one of the most important phone and internet providers in the Netherlands, was the victim of a cyberattack that compromised sensitive data of its customers and internal systems. Although the exact details of the intrusion are still being investigated, the fact that authorities suspect local actors underscores a troubling trend: cybercrime is no longer exclusive to international groups or nation states, but also arises from within the borders themselves. From a technical perspective, breaches in telecommunications operators often exploit vulnerabilities in critical infrastructures, such as billing systems, customer databases, or network management platforms. In many cases, attackers use social engineering techniques, targeted phishing, or exploit flaws in software that has not been properly updated or patched. Precisely, the lack of maintenance in custom applications can turn an apparently secure system into an open door for cybercriminals. Therefore, organizations that operate with their own developments must prioritize periodic security audits and penetration tests (pentesting) to identify and correct vulnerabilities before they are exploited.
The case of Odido also highlights the relevance of having well-configured AWS and Azure cloud services. Many telcos migrate their workloads to the cloud to gain scalability and efficiency, but misconfiguring cloud environments can expose critical data. Adopting secure architectures, proper access controls, and the principle of least privilege are imperative practices. In parallel, continuous monitoring and threat intelligence make it possible to detect anomalous behavior that could indicate an attack in progress.
